Re: [RC] Wisp monster

Post by Crush »

I would suggest the following stats compared to other monsters in its level area:

evade: high
defence: high
hit points: very low
speed: average
damage: below average
crit rate: high
aggressive: no

Note that the monster is recolorable. That means that it would be possible to create different versions for different level areas or with different attributes.

Re: Wisp monster stats

Post by Frictor »

When first envisioned, I wanted the wisp to have much of the same settings as Crush proposes. Though an aggro personality and low crit rate would be where I diverge from him on it. I liked the idea of it being an annoyance, but not a threat.

Also, I wanted to have it easier to hit with magic attacks, than with physical ones, but since magic hasn't yet been implemented on Aethyra, that notion has been put on the wayside for the time being. Maybe you can do something with it here.
